-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于P2P和CDN混合流媒体分发模型及分析
基于P2P和CDN混合流媒体分发模型及分析
摘 要:在CDN和P2P两种主流的流媒体分发技术的基础上,提出了基于系统流量的混合流媒体分发模型,根据系统中节点数量和媒体流量之间的关系,在CDN自治域内实现CDN和P2P的混合式服务,并对上述理论进行了仿真。实验结果表明,与传统的CDN和P2P相比,新的混合模型既可以减少主干网络的流量,又能在不降低流媒体质量的情况下,有效降低CDN服务器压力,减少系统的响应时间,提高网络利用率。
关键词:内容分发网络; 对等网络; 流媒体; 混合流媒体分发模型
中图分类号:TP393文献标志码:A
文章编号:1001-3695(2010)06-2208-03
doi:10.3969/j.issn.1001-3695.2010.06.060
Hybrid streaming media distribution model based on P2P and CDN
ZANG Yun??gang, CHEN Guang??xi
(College of Computer Control, Guilin University of Electronic Technology, Guilin Guangxi 541004, China)
Abstract:Based on CDN and P2P, this paper provided a new HSDM. According to the relation of peers and streaming capacity in the system, realized and then simulated the hybrid model. The result shows that compared with traditional CDN and P2P, this new hybrid model obviously reduces the flow of backbone network. And also, with this new method can effectively reduce the pressure of CDN severs and the response time of system without compromising the media quality delivered, and increases the network utilization.
Key words:CDN(content distribution network); P2P(peer??to??peer); streaming media; hybrid streaming media distribution model (HSDM)
0 引言
随着网络技术的进步,人们对所分发的实时流媒体的质量和分发速度提出了更高的要求。在实时流媒体分发领域,最为常用的是CDN和P2P两种技术。
CDN技术最初用于Web服务。当用户向Web服务器发送请求时,利用DNS的重定向机制,将其重定向到离用户最近或负载最低的CDN服务器上,以加快响应速度和优化热点内容分布,达到平衡Web服务器负载和降低网络带宽消耗的目的。这一技术同样可以应用于网络流媒体服务。由于流媒体本身的特点,大量用户对热点文件的重复请求,使得网络中存在大量冗余数据,CDN服务器的处理能力和出口带宽就成为系统瓶颈;另外,CDN服务器部署和维护的高费用,也增加了服务提供商和客户的成本。当前相关研究主要从副本放置算法[1]、内容路由[2]、负载均衡和重定向机制[3]等方面对CDN技术进行了改进,使得系统的服务性能和健壮性得到了提高,但是仍未能有效解决网络流量消耗和系统瓶颈的问题。
与CDN不同,P2P内部所有节点的地位均等,节点之间不需要互联网路由器和网络基础设施的支持,成本低、易于部署;同时,P2P节点在下载文件时还上传给其他请求节点,扩大了用户组的规模,提高了系统效率。然而,由于没用中心服务器,P2P节点之间的内容交换缺乏统一的管理,内容的安全性无法保证;流媒体分发时需调动较多的种子节点,节点之间的频繁交互占用了大量带宽;在节点数目太少时,会造成网络传输中断。目前大量研究分别从文件访问控制机制[4]、容错机制和节点激励机制[5]角度,对P2P进行了改进,但仍不能有效降低主干网络流量,流媒体分发的启动速度仍然与种子节点的数量密切相关。
目前,国内外对于CDN和P2P的混合结构的研究尚处于起步阶段。文献[6]提出了基于泛洪的紧急消息广播技术,但是不
文档评论(0)